Physiological Equilibrium Achievement

Meaning

Physiological Equilibrium Achievement is the therapeutic end-state where all major regulatory systems—endocrine, immune, metabolic, and neurological—operate in a harmonious, dynamically stable state, allowing the body to efficiently adapt to internal and external stressors. This achievement signifies a successful return to optimal homeostasis, characterized by symptom resolution, enhanced vitality, and robust biological resilience. It is the core objective of all restorative health interventions.
